Driving There: Rush Creek Lodge is right outside of Yosemite, and is about a 6 hour drive from Los Angeles. We understand that this is a long drive, and we are so grateful that you are able to make it! Rush Creek Lodge lies within the Sierra Nevada mountains, 1 mile west of the Yosemite Big Oak Flat entrance station on HWY 120. While we have had no issues with reception, having a downloaded or printed map of the area is always ideal when traveling through the mountains. Self-parking is included without fee at Rush Creek Lodge. Flying In: We recommend flying into Sacramento International Airport (SMF) if planning on renting a vehicle - 3 hour drive to Rush Creek Lodge Other airports in the area include: San Francisco International Airport (SFO) 4 hour drive Oakland International Airport (OAK) 3.5 hour drive San Jose International Airport (SJC) 3 hour drive Fresno-Yosemite Airport (FAT) 3 hour drive Merced Airport (MCE) 2 hour drive
